Distance From Awasa Airport to National Airport (AWA - BRU Distance)

The flight distance from Awasa Airport (AWA) to National Airport (BRU) is 3600 miles. This is equivalent to 5794 kilometers or 3127 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.


5794 kilometers is the distance from Awasa Airport, Ethiopia to National Airport, Belgium.


Flight Duration between Awasa, Ethiopia and Brussels, Belgium

Estimated flight time from Awasa Airport, Awasa, Ethiopia to National Airport, Brussels, Belgium is 7 hours 12 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
